How to Commission a Portrait from Cumberland County, ME

Commissioning a portrait from Hazel Morgan is a collaborative and enjoyable experience, regardless of where you are located in Cumberland County, ME. The process has been refined over hundreds of commissions to ensure a seamless experience for every client.

Step 1: Initial Consultation

The process begins with a complimentary consultation - by telephone, video call, or email - during which Hazel discusses your vision for the portrait. This covers the subject, preferred composition, size, background, clothing, and any particular details you would like to include. There is no obligation at this stage.

Step 2: Photographs & References

For clients in Cumberland County, ME, Hazel can work from professional photographs, high-quality personal photographs, or a combination of multiple reference images. She provides clear guidance on the types of photographs that produce the best results. Where feasible, live sittings can also be arranged.

Step 3: The Painting Process

Once the composition is agreed, Hazel begins painting. The process typically takes between six and twelve weeks depending on the complexity of the piece. Clients receive progress photographs at key stages so you can see the portrait taking shape and provide feedback before completion.

Step 4: Delivery & Framing

Completed portraits are professionally packaged for shipping. Shipping and framing costs are provided once the painting is complete. Hazel can also recommend master framers who specialise in fine art framing to complement your finished portrait. Clients in Cumberland County, ME typically receive their portrait within one to two weeks of completion.

Frequently Asked Questions - Portrait Commissions in Cumberland County, ME

How do I get a quotation for a portrait?

Hazel provides personalized quotations after an initial telephone consultation, during which she discusses your specific requirements. The consultation is complimentary and entirely without obligation. Please get in touch to arrange a convenient time to talk.

Do I need to sit for the portrait in person?

Not at all. The majority of Hazel’s commissions are painted from photographs, which makes the process convenient for clients in Cumberland County, ME and beyond. Hazel provides guidance on the best types of photographs to supply. Live sittings can be arranged where practical.

How long does a portrait take to complete?

Most portraits are completed within six to twelve weeks from the start of painting, depending on the complexity of the commission. Hazel provides a realistic timeline during the initial consultation. Rush commissions can sometimes be accommodated for special occasions.

Can you paint from old or low-quality photographs?

Hazel has extensive experience working with a range of photographic references, including older or lower-resolution images. She can often combine multiple photographs to create a single cohesive portrait. During the consultation, she will advise on whether your available photographs are suitable.

How is the finished portrait delivered to Cumberland County, ME?

Completed portraits are professionally packaged using custom-built crating and shipped via insured courier directly to your address in Cumberland County, ME. Shipping and framing are quoted separately after the portrait is completed.

What if I am not happy with the portrait?

Client satisfaction is paramount. Hazel shares progress photographs at key stages throughout the painting process so you can provide feedback and request adjustments. This collaborative approach means that by the time the portrait is complete, it faithfully reflects your vision.
